Statuette of Hapy
Nubian
Napatan Period, reign of Piankhy (Piye)
743–712 B.C.
Findspot: Sudan, Nubia, el-Kurru, KU. 53
Medium/Technique
Bronze
Dimensions
Legacy dimension: H. 0.072
Credit Line
Harvard University—Boston Museum of Fine Arts Expedition
Accession Number24.1009
NOT ON VIEW
CollectionsAncient Egypt, Nubia and the Near East
ClassificationsSculpture
DescriptionHapy. Mummiform figure with ape head. Thin metal filled with paste. Somewhat corroded. (forms set with 24.1007, 1008, 1010)
ProvenanceFrom el-Kurru, Ku. 53 (Tomb of Queen Tabiry). 1919: excavated by the Harvard University–Boston Museum of Fine Arts Expedition; assigned to the MFA in the division of finds by the government of Sudan.
